Subject: Hiring Freeze — Meridian Tooling Division

Dear Ms. Calloway,

As you step into the director role, please be aware that all requisitions in the Meridian Tooling division are frozen effective immediately. Backfills require my written approval; contractor extensions beyond sixty days do as well. The freeze follows a margin review completed last month and is expected to hold through two quarters. Recruiting partners have been notified. The broader reasoning is captured in the confidential note appended below.

internal memo for yahof-bajop: Tamethox Group is in early talks to buy Ulamirek Group for about $64.0 million. The Aldiel launch date is October 11, and nothing goes to the press before then.

Subject: Sorting stability ownership change in Quillwright Report Builder

Hello plugin authors,

Starting next sprint, responsibility for sort-order guarantees in the Quillwright Report Builder moves to a new maintainer. Stable sorting across grouped columns remains the contract; any plugin relying on undocumented tie-breaking should migrate to the comparator API. Direct all questions about stability regressions or comparator behavior to the new owner going forward.

account owner for bawip-tahag: Raleth Quenok

Ticket TL-442: The staging instance of Chronoplan, our school timetable solver, was deployed with the production solver queue credentials. This means staging runs can enqueue jobs against live district schedules at Hollowbrook Academy. We need to rotate the affected credential and point staging at its own queue. For the security review, note that the fix requires updating the staging .env with the following line:

vault entry, tagug-hahip: ARCHIVE_KEY3=e34

## RateSentinel: restart procedure

The RateSentinel parity checker compares published room rates across the Quillmark booking feeds every fifteen minutes. If the comparison worker stalls, first confirm the feed poller is healthy before restarting anything, since a blind restart can double-scrape and trip the upstream rate limits. Restart the worker only, not the scheduler. After restart, verify the queue drains within two cycles. The running instance expects the following configuration values.

deployment values, yadug-bawif:
[framir]
team = pelox
access_code = ac_a38ab2
owner = tamion.julael
host = framir.tolvaqlabs.test
port = 11211
peer = tammir.zemvargrid.local
salt = 2215ef03
pin = 1541